shogun assassin (1980)

Shogun Assassin was edited and compiled from the first two Lone Wolf and Cub films, for an American audience. This version is narrated by the child, Daigoro, and tells of how the Shogun tries to kill the titular Samurai, but only succeeds in killing his wife. Itto seeking revenge becomes a Ronin, a lone wolf, wandering Japan as a hired assassin with his child, chased by the Shogun's men.
This results in almost wall to wall fighting, with over the top blood spraying from every concieveable body part. Some dislike this, prefering the original Lone Wolf films. Me I like them all. Lone Wolf is inevitably more complex and requres more time and effort, but Shogun Assassin is great for a quick fix. Added to this is the throbbing synth theme, that I love, and I'm not the only one: the Wu-Tang Clan obviously enjoyed it as well, as did Quentin Tarantino.
